Output 8a4adb3453e61c320b53e1c7d1c13d70ec6e29d05a20a2502874c95fca4416e1:0

value
145421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b1817915fa6d729c81d1403d473e97bb16ed85f OP_EQUAL
address
375UeontUaCsgzeRS8MgFuBezH5U3qyRS5
transaction
8a4adb3453e61c320b53e1c7d1c13d70ec6e29d05a20a2502874c95fca4416e1
confirmations
320888
spent
true